Irumudi ended its first weekend with Rs. 50.50 crore net in India after a Sunday collection of Rs. 19 crore. The Ravi Teja-led film, directed by Shiva Nirvana, opened with Rs. 15.30 crore on Friday before rising to Rs. 16.20 crore on Saturday. Its India gross reached Rs. 58.65 crore, while Rs. 13.50 crore from international markets lifted worldwide gross to Rs. 72.15 crore.
Shiva Nirvana's Irumudi, starring Ravi Teja in the lead role, was released on Friday. The film took a good opening at the box office and collected Rs. 15.30 crore net. The movie received mixed reviews from critics and the audience, but it showed a jump on Saturday and collected Rs. 16.20 crore net.
According to Sacnilk, on Sunday, the movie minted Rs. 19 crore net, taking the total to Rs. 50.50 crore net, which is surely a good amount. The gross collection of Irumudi in India stands at Rs. 58.65 crore.
Irumudi Worldwide Box Office Collection
Internationally, Irumudi collected Rs. 13.50 crore gross, taking the worldwide gross collection to Rs. 72.15 crore.
